This past Sunday was the NW Toy Run Meet at Pacific Raceways and I must say that it was pretty awesome. There was a great turn out and a variety of different cars. I got there around 12:30pm and there was already a lot of cars. I ran into some friends and saw a lot of familiar faces.

There were many cars that I haven’t seen before and some that I’ve seen at other meets. It gives me a good feeling to see so many people come together for this cause and to donate toys for children in need.

According to NW Toy Run’s Facebook, there was a total of about 2000+ cars and they managed to fill their trailer with lots of toys. Last year, they had a turn out of about 1300 cars and filled up a 27′ trailer with toys. Also, they raised about $3500 to give to those in need.


I give the guys at NW Toy Run props for putting these events together and they’ve been around since 2004. They use the power of the car community to their advantage and they are using it for a great cause. They have their minds and their hearts in the right place.
